Plagiarism

Plagiarism is presenting the words, ideas, images, sounds, or the creative expression of others as your own else can be defined as the piece of work copied entirely from one or more sources.

• Authors retain Copy Rights
• Attribute references
• Describing all sources of information
• Giving acknowledgments
• Providing footnotes
• Paraphrasing the original, attributed work
• For extensive quotations, obtain permission from the publisher of the original work
• Avoiding self-plagiarism by taking permission from the publisher of the previous article authored by you Obtaining permission for use of published drawings or other illustrations
